The sekt Oliver Zeter Zeró Grande Cuvée Brut Nature, vintage 2019 from the winery Weingut Oliver Zeter has been rated in 2024 by Peter Moser, Gerhild Burkhard, Benjamin Herzog, Dominik Vombach, Ulrich Sautter, Othmar Kiem, Simon Staffler with 93 Falstaff points. It is a wine made from the grape varieties Pinot Noir, Chardonnay
Tasting Notes
Disgorged 11/23. A nuanced Pinot nose with subtle yeasty notes underneath and some apple peel, completely Champagne-like in character. In the mouth a very fine mousse is followed by a compact finish that weaves together the ripe but well-sustained acidity with subtle mineral tones and a somewhat dry phenolic note. Very well composed!
